Es una información
estructurada para
acceder y gestionar
fácilmente
Es la administración de datos a
través de un sistema de gestión
de base de datos (Database
Management system DBMS)
Tipos de Base de Datos
Se clasifican en
Bases de Datos Orientadas a Objectos: Se basa en la programación
a objectos (POO), por lo que todos sus datos y atributos están
unidos como un objecto.
Bases de Columnas Anchas: Son escalables y permiten
soportar aplicaciones de Big data en tiempo real.
Ejemplo: BigTable, Apache Cassandra y Scylla.
Base de Datos en Columna: Guarda los
datos en columnas en lugar de fila, se
utilizan en los grandes almacenes de
datos para realizar consultas analíticas.
Ejemplos: Google BigQuery, Cassandra,
Hbase, MariaDB, Azure SQL Data
Warehouse.
Base de Datos NoSQL o no relacionales: Es excelente para
las organizaciones que buscan almacenar datos no
estructurados o semiestructurados. Ejemplo: MongoDB,
Redis, Apache Cassandra, Apache CouchDB, Couchbase.
Base de Datos en la Nube: Se entregangan como un servicio desde
la nube su creación, mantenimieto y escalabilidad son competencia
del proveedor de este servicio. Ejemplo: Google Firebase, Microsoft
Azure SQL Database, Amazon Relational Database Service, Oracle
Autonomous Database.
Base de Datos Relacionales: Se utilizan cuando son
consistentes y ya cuentan con una estructura
planificada. Ejemplo: MySQL, Microsoft SQL Server,
Oracle Database, PostgreSQL, IBM Db2.
Base de Datos de Series Temporales (time
series): Esta base de datos están optimizadas
para llevar una marca de tiempo lo que las
hace útiles para monitoreo. Ejemplo: Druid,
extremeDB y InfluxDB
Base de Datos Graficas o de Grafos (graph): Se emplean
para analizar las relaciones entre puntos de datos
heterogéneos y encontrar relaciones. Ejemplo: Datastax
Enterprise Graph y Neo4J AuraDB
Base de Datos Documentales: Estan diseñadas para
almacenar y gestionar información orientada a
documentos útiles para las aplicaciones móviles.
Ejemplos: Mongo DB, Amazon DocumentDB, Apache
CouchDB.
Base de Datos Jerarquicas: Se utilizan para soportar
aplicaciones de alto rendimiento y alta disponibilidad.
Ejemplo: Sistema de Gestion de la Informacion de IBM
(IMS) y Registro de Windows.
Base de Datos Clave-Valor (Key-value): Guarda los datos como un
grupo de pares clave-valor, son escalables y pueden manejar
grande volumen de trafico para procesos de gestión y aplicaciones
Web.
NOMBRES: Jhon Velandia- Jesus Beltran-
Angie Murcia- Juan Sabino-Eliana Mesias